How to avoid battery discharge in cold weather?

To avoid battery discharge in cold weather, there are several key steps you can take to ensure your vehicle’s battery remains in optimal condition. Firstly, it is important to keep your car parked in a garage or covered area whenever possible to shield it from the extreme cold temperatures.

This will help to maintain a more stable temperature for the battery, preventing it from losing power more quickly. Additionally, using a battery blanket or insulation wrap can help to keep the battery warm and prevent it from freezing in extremely cold conditions.

It is also important to limit the use of power-hungry accessories such as heated seats or defrosters when the engine is not running, as this can drain the battery more quickly. Regularly starting your vehicle and allowing it to run for a few minutes can also help to keep the battery charged and prevent it from discharging in cold weather.

By following these tips, you can help to prolong the life of your battery and avoid unexpected issues during the winter months.

What steps can be taken to prevent battery discharge in cold weather?

To prevent battery discharge in cold weather, there are several effective measures that can be implemented to maintain the optimal condition of your vehicle’s battery. Firstly, it is advisable to park your car in a garage or covered area whenever possible to shield it from the harsh cold temperatures.

This will help to stabilize the temperature around the battery, reducing the likelihood of discharge. Additionally, utilizing a battery blanket or insulation wrap can assist in keeping the battery warm and preventing power loss in cold weather conditions.

Regularly inspecting the battery’s connections and terminals for any signs of corrosion or damage is crucial, as these issues can contribute to battery discharge. Furthermore, starting your vehicle frequently and allowing it to run for a few minutes can aid in keeping the battery charged and preventing power loss.

By implementing these proactive measures, you can effectively maintain the health of your battery and avoid the inconvenience of a dead battery in cold weather.

How can parking in a garage help maintain a stable temperature for the battery?

Parking in a garage can help maintain a stable temperature for the battery by providing protection from extreme weather conditions. Batteries are sensitive to temperature fluctuations, and exposure to high or low temperatures can affect their performance and lifespan.

By parking in a garage, the battery is shielded from the scorching heat of the sun in the summer and the freezing cold in the winter. This stable temperature environment helps prevent the battery from overheating or freezing, which can lead to damage and reduced efficiency.

Additionally, garages offer insulation that can help regulate the temperature inside, keeping it more consistent than if the vehicle were parked outside. This controlled environment is especially beneficial for electric vehicles, as extreme temperatures can have a significant impact on their battery life and overall performance.

Overall, parking in a garage provides a protective barrier against temperature extremes, ensuring that the battery remains in optimal condition for longer periods of time.

How does regularly starting the vehicle help prevent battery discharge in cold weather?

Regularly starting the vehicle in cold weather can help prevent battery discharge by allowing the alternator to recharge the battery. When a vehicle sits idle for an extended period in cold temperatures, the battery can lose its charge due to the increased strain placed on it by the cold weather.

By starting the vehicle regularly, even if it is not being driven, the alternator is activated, which in turn charges the battery. This helps to maintain the battery’s charge and prevent it from discharging completely. Additionally, starting the vehicle periodically can also help to keep the engine components lubricated and prevent them from seizing up in the cold weather.

It is important to note that simply starting the vehicle without driving it for a sufficient amount of time may not be effective in preventing battery discharge, as the alternator needs to run for a certain period to fully recharge the battery.

Therefore, it is recommended to start the vehicle and let it run for at least 10-15 minutes to ensure the battery is adequately charged. By following these practices, you can help prevent battery discharge in cold weather and ensure your vehicle is ready to start when you need it.
